Re: AO40 RCV
Nope, you don't have a problem. I noticed that exact same thing over the
weekend. If you listen closely, there are blocks that AO40RCV doesn't even
attempt to decode. My guess is these are blocks that are using the new FEC
encoding and that they have suspended the other blocks while they are test
the FEC telemetry.
